Avoid These Common Editorial Mistakes
Confusing implied vs realized volatility
Mispriced options leading to systematic trading losses
Incorrect Greek notation or calculations
Failed hedging strategies and uncontrolled portfolio risk
Monte Carlo parameter specification errors
Invalid simulation results affecting pricing accuracy
Wrong risk measure calculations
Regulatory violations and capital requirement miscalculations
Stochastic process misspecification
Fundamentally flawed pricing models and strategy failures

Prioritize candidates who distinguish between implied and realized volatility, understand Greeks notation (delta, gamma, theta, vega), and correctly use stochastic calculus terminology. Test their ability to edit Monte Carlo simulation parameters, finite difference method descriptions, and derivatives pricing algorithm documentation. Look for precision in mathematical notation, understanding of hedging strategies terminology, and accuracy in risk metrics calculations. Knowledge of numerical methods for PDE solving and fixed-income modeling terminology indicates advanced competency.
Computational finance documentation contains complex mathematical models where terminology errors can invalidate trading algorithms and risk calculations. Precise language skills ensure accurate communication of quantitative strategies and regulatory compliance in derivatives trading.
